Solomon Gumball posted:I was a DJ at KALX for a few years. Solid enough station but nothing really outside of a regular college station, I guess. They did get considerably good interviews, concert sponsors, community stuff compared to other stations I've been with. I was too! Well, I did 3-6am training shifts. Never had a regular slot. I liked the Sunday morning hip hop show with DJ Pone and Billy Jam from Hip Hop Slam records, and the overall mix on KALX was a higher "keep listening" rate than KZSU, where I also briefly worked, and KFJC. Like, more consistent. But KZSU had The Drum and Japanic and Club Manic-Consciousness and various other great shows. They have really good live artists too. KFJC was the weirdest, they'd do stuff like 24 hours of Sun Ra or 24 hours of noise... when you found something cool on it it was insanely cool, if you know what I mean. Higher highs and lower lows of like "I'm switching this RIGHT the gently caress off". For example, KFJC had "Skulltime for Kids", with two guys doing pirate voices hosting a show where they played old storytelling records and stuff, which I loved back in the day.

https://wncw.org they're out of Spindale, NC, kind of near Asheville. singer-songwriter stuff, jazz, and (most of all) old-time music of various kinds. they still have actual DJs and they're all massive music nerds. they used to do a 4:20 (AM) jam of the day before the last stragglers found out what that refers to. they still do a "new tunes at 2" (PM) thing every weekday that focuses on a new album. couple of NPR/PRI news and music shows, a bunch of genre music shows, generally good stuff. https://wfpk.org out of Louisville. I'm not as familiar with it, but it's largely similar to the above description, but with old-school and underground rap.

CKUA out of Alberta is one of the things that makes living here bearable. They're Canada's oldest public broadcaster, having been on air since 1927, and play a bit of everything. https://ckua.com/

precision posted:oh yeah archive.org has a fuckload of Negativland's radio shows... Over The Edge... it's a lot to sort through but there are shows on alllllll kinds of topics, basically anything ur interested in there's gonna be at least one 5 hour show about it worth noting what Over The Edge is, exactly - it's a live-mixed soundscape collage where you can often just call in and go directly to air in the mix, no screening. it's like collaborative documentary sometimes, other times it's like a bunch of sound collage artists trying to out-esoteric each other live. it's really the most incredible concept and execution for a radio show I've ever come across and the fact that it's been going for so long is mind boggling. i used to call into OTE and play downloaded samples off my computer and poo poo. i remember i recorded myself groaning on a minicassette and played it back at half speed, randomly high speed squeal-rewinding it, for AGES and they just incorporated it into the background mix. i wish i knew which episodes they were. I recorded some off the air bits where me and my dumbshit buddies got on but many more i didn't bother. i recommend anybody to listen to over the edge, but especially as it was intended: between the hours of midnight and 5am alone on headphones.
